Dheepak Krishnamurthy is a Technical Leader in the Energy Systems and Climate Analysis Group at EPRI. His research focuses on developing advanced analytical tools and methodologies for energy systems analysis. He has been a key contributor to EPRI’s Integrated Strategic Planning (ISSP) Initiative and ClimateREADi Initiative, with research focusing on long-term capacity expansion planning, production cost modeling and resource adequacy studies.
Before joining EPRI, Dheepak worked at the Environment and Climate Change Canada (ECCC) as a Senior Economic Advisor and at the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L) as a Research Engineer.
He holds a Bachelor of Technology in Electrical Engineering from the SSN College of Engineering (Chennai, TN, India), a Master of Science in Electrical Engineering from Iowa State University (Ames, IA, USA).
